Key Qualifications:
Certification and registration in MRI through ARRT or equivalent Valid state licensure to perform MRI in Pennsylvania (or ability to obtain) Experience with advanced MRI techniques and protocols Strong communication and patient care abilities Adaptability to different clinical environments
Key Responsibilities:
Perform high-quality MRI scans as prescribed by physicians Ensure patient safety, comfort, and proper positioning throughout procedures Operate and troubleshoot MRI equipment and software systems Accurately document patient records and maintain stringent data privacy Collaborate with referring clinicians and peer imaging professionals to optimize patient outcomes
